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.

Dva ili više comp.????????

[es] :: Access :: Dva ili više comp.????????

[ Pregleda: 2400 | Odgovora: 1 ] > FB > Twit

Postavi temu Odgovori

Autor

Pretraga teme: Traži
Markiranje Štampanje RSS

deno d
denis d.

Član broj: 75062
Poruke: 2
*.adsl.net.t-com.hr.



Profil

icon Dva ili više comp.????????07.12.2005. u 23:31 - pre 181 meseci
Evo nešto jednostavno za vas a za mene ne!!!!
Šta se treba napraviti odn. kako se treba baza u accessu postaviti da bi istovremeno dva umrežena compu. radila na njoj (INSERT INTO...UPDATE...).
Program je rađen u VB6,a podatke vadi iz tablice u accessu.Grešku u VB6 koju stalno javlja:
"The database has been placed in a state by user 'Admin' on machine 'K-27374575' that prevents it from being opened or locked."
Ili mi samo recite dali je to do accessa ili do VB6,pa ako je do VB6 postaviti ću temu na VB6 forumu.
Hvala!
 
Odgovor na temu

Zidar
Canada

Moderator
Član broj: 15387
Poruke: 3085
*.eqao.com.



+78 Profil

icon Re: Dva ili više comp.????????08.12.2005. u 15:50 - pre 181 meseci
Proveri da li ti je Access baza u 'shared' ili 'exclusive' modu. Ako je 'exclusive' onda B ne moze nista da radi dok A ne zavrsi.

Proveri svoje ADO naredbe koje vrse INSERT/UPDATE. Da nije tamo neko zakljucavanje u pitanju?

Zavisno od verizje Accessa, zakljucavanje moze biti na novou rekorda ili na 'page' nivou. Ako korisnik A izvrsi INSERT/UPDATE i ostavi otvoren recordset, B nece moci da mu pristupi. Ako je zakljucabvanje na nivou strane (page), onda se zakljuca cela strana kad neko nesto radi sa bilo kojim rekordom na toj strani.

Znaci, moze biti i jedno i drugo, i Access i VBA.

:-)
 
Odgovor na temu

[es] :: Access :: Dva ili više comp.????????

[ Pregleda: 2400 | Odgovora: 1 ] > FB > Twit

Postavi temu Odgovori

Navigacija
Lista poslednjih: 16, 32, 64, 128 poruka.